设置 tomcat 的位置 (jre:并不是jdk)

打开 struts2目录:
apps 示例程序
docs 文档
lib 类库
src 源码

打开 apps 目录下的 struts2-blank.war 项目
1、拷贝 struts2-blank\WEB-INF\classes 文件夹下的 strut2.xml 文件到 src 目录下;
2、拷贝 struts2-blank\WEB-INF\lib 下的所有 jar 包到lib目录下,导入项目;


  tip:切换 navigator 可以看所在项目的所有文件
3、对于web.xml 的配置

拷贝 struts2-blank\WEB-INF\web.xml的配置

 1 <?xml version="1.0" encoding="UTF-8"?>
 2 <web-app x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://java.sun.com/xml/ns/javaee" x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_3_0.xsd" id="WebApp_ID" version="3.0">
 3   <display-name>Struts2_0100_Introduction</display-name>
 4
 5     <filter>
 6         <filter-name>struts2</filter-name>
 7         <filter-class>org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ter</filter-class>
 8     </filter>
 9
10     <filter-mapping>
11         <filter-name>struts2</filter-name>
12         <url-pattern>/*</url-pattern>
13     </filter-mapping>
14
15     <welcome-file-list>
16         <welcome-file>index.jsp</welcome-file>
17     </welcome-file-list>
18 </web-app>

当前项目版本是 struts-2.3.16.1,所有配置的filter是 org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ter。

StrutsPrepareAndExecuteFilter 2.1 以后,DispatcherFilter 是 2.0。这些都参考示例空白项目的配置。

这样空白的项目就建好了。

代码链接:http://pan.baidu.com/s/1kV4uTBx 提取码:5mjj

转载于:https://www.cnblogs.com/ShawnYang/p/6668306.html

Struts2_HelloWorld_2相关推荐

最新文章

  1. 搭建卷积神经网络怎么确定参数_AI入门:卷积神经网络
  2. 同事更新几个表_最近计划学习的几个网站资源
  3. android启动效果
  4. [深度学习] 深度学习常见概念
  5. np-hard证明实例 规约
  6. ADB Interface显示黄色惊叹号怎么办?
  7. paip.日期时间操作以及时间戳uapi php java python 总结
  8. KITTI数据集Raw Data与Ground Truth序列00-10的对应关系,以及对应的标定参数
  9. LCD12864显示屏原理及使用教程
  10. Android 各大市场更改APP名称
  11. 鸿蒙系统翻车了,鸿蒙系统翻车了?任正非承认忽视了关键问题,称华为犯下大错误...
  12. WordPress采集插件推荐都是免费采集插件
  13. (二)Chrome新标签页的设置
  14. 诺基亚wp手机安装linux,1小时搞定 普通用户3步轻松更新WP8.1
  15. 开发一款系统软件大概需要多少钱呢
  16. TableView下拉刷新崩溃
  17. 如何设计好一个接口?
  18. 饿了么技术往事(下)
  19. 将la,lb链表合并成lc。
  20. C++详解:枚举类型 --- enum | Xunlan_blog

热门文章

  1. CSS自学笔记(16):CSS3 用户界面
  2. hdu3870——平面图最小割
  3. 11款有用的Web开发在线工具
  4. 敲诈勒索罪无罪裁判要旨汇总
  5. C++ sprintf 函数的使用
  6. MySQL优化之三:SQL语句优化
  7. [转] Java中的static关键字解析
  8. 微信小程序实现支付功能
  9. Ubuntu 14.10安装libvirt KVM
  10. 使用JScript设置SVN客户端hook